- What is Green Dot's consumer services — total costs & expenses?
- Green Dot (GDOT) reported consumer services — total costs & expenses of $61.01M in Q1 2026.
- How has Green Dot's consumer services — total costs & expenses changed year-over-year?
- Green Dot's consumer services — total costs & expenses decreased by 1.0% year-over-year, from $61.62M to $61.01M.
- What is the long-term trend for Green Dot's consumer services — total costs & expenses?
-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), Green Dot's consumer services — total costs & expenses has grown at a -13.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$364.65M to $233.64M.
- What does consumer services — total costs & expenses mean?
- The aggregate of all operating costs, including marketing, processing, fraud losses, and support, incurred by the Consumer Services segment. This metric provides a comprehensive view of the total expenditure required to generate the segment's revenue. It is essential for calculating the segment's operating margin and overall cost efficiency.
